Sign up to access all features of our service.
  • Job search
  • Favorites
  • Create a CV
    New
  • Salaries
  • Subscriptions

Staff Software Engineer, Data Infrastructure

$200k - $275k

Peregrine Corporation

Staff Software Engineer, Data Infrastructure

Peregrine helps public safety organizations, state and local governments, federal agencies, and private-sector institutions address society's challenges with unprecedented speed and accuracy. Our AI-enabled platform turns siloed and disconnected data into operational intelligence — instantly surfacing mission-critical information to empower better, faster decisions that improve outcomes at every touchpoint. Today Peregrine supports hundreds of customers across 30+ states and two countries, serving more than 125 million people — and we're amplifying our impact as we expand into the enterprise and internationally.

Team

As an engineering team, we believe strongly that empathy improves our solutions. Seeing how people use the product is a priority and the way we get to the right answer. Engineers will have the opportunity to work closely with our team onsite to understand the variety of use cases that Peregrine serves.

We value both ownership and collaboration—you will take full responsibility for major features and work closely with other engineers to drive them to completion. We believe that humility and empathy are essential for building the right solutions—you will collaborate directly with our deployment team and users as we iterate to solve their problems. Perseverance and creativity are crucial to executing our vision.

Role

We are looking for a Staff Data Infrastructure Engineer to join our growing team, where you will have deep ownership over the data layer that underpins everything Peregrine does. You will architect and build the systems that ingest, store, and serve massive volumes of real-time operational data — enabling our customers to make critical decisions with speed and confidence.

This is a senior individual contributor role for someone who thrives on hard technical problems and brings the experience and judgment to shape foundational infrastructure decisions. You will tackle a wide range of complex challenges, including:

  • Designing and operating a high-throughput, real-time data integration platform across diverse customer environments
  • Architecting a scalable open table format layer for reliable data storage at petabyte scale
  • Building and optimizing distributed data processing pipelines with Apache Spark and adjacent streaming technologies
  • Driving performance, reliability, and cost efficiency across the full data infrastructure stack
  • Collaborating with platform and product engineering teams to define data contracts, schemas, and integration patterns
  • Establishing best practices, tooling, and patterns that raise the quality bar for data infrastructure across the organization

Our stack is constantly evolving but is built on AWS GovCloud, Apache Iceberg, Apache Spark, Apache Kafka, Airflow, Kubernetes, and more.

About You
  • Deep passion for data infrastructure — you care about building systems that are correct, fast, and resilient at scale
  • Thrive on ambiguity and are energized by defining the right solution to hard, open-ended problems
  • Strong technical vision with the ability to translate complex data requirements into clean, durable infrastructure designs
  • Desire to own significant portions of the data stack end-to-end, from ingestion to serving
  • Committed to operational excellence — you build things you're proud to operate
What We Look For
  • 8+ years of experience architecting and operating large-scale data infrastructure systems in production environments
  • Deep expertise with open table formats, particularly Apache Iceberg — including schema evolution, partitioning strategies, compaction, and time travel
  • Extensive hands-on experience with Apache Spark for batch and streaming data processing at scale
  • Strong background in real-time data integration and stream processing, leveraging technologies such as Apache Kafka, Apache Flink, or equivalents
  • Solid experience with data pipeline orchestration using Airflow or similar tools
  • Strong software engineering fundamentals in Python and/or Scala, with a track record of writing production-quality code
  • Extensive experience with AWS or comparable cloud platforms, including S3-based data lake architectures
  • Experience with Kubernetes and containerized deployment of data workloads
  • Degree in Computer Science, Engineering, or a related field, or equivalent practical experience

Located in San Francisco, New York, or Washington DC and open to working in office

Salary Range: $200,000 - $275,000 Annually + Benefits + Equity (if applicable) + Bonus (if applicable)

Peregrine Technologies is committed to creating an inclusive environment for all employees. We celebrate diversity and are a proud equal opportunity employ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, gender, gender identity or expression, sexual orientation, national origin, genetics, disability, age, or veteran status.

Vacancy posted 3 days ago
Similar jobs that could be interesting for youBased on the Staff Software Engineer, Data Infrastructure in Washington DC vacancy
  •  ...Staff Software Engineer Praia is seeking a Staff Software Engineer to serve as a technical anchor...  .... If you thrive on bridging complex data engineering workloads with secure,...  ...automated testing (unit/integration), infrastructure-as-code, monitoring/logging, and data... 
    Suggested
    Full time
    Temporary work
    H1b
    Visa sponsorship
    Work visa
    Flexible hours

    Praia Health

    Washington DC
    3 days ago
  • $100k - $230k

     ...Careers. Position Summary GEICO is seeking an experienced Staff Software Engineer with a passion for building high-performance, low maintenance, zero-downtime platforms, and core data infrastructure. You will help drive our insurance business transformation as we... 
    Suggested
    Hourly pay
    Work experience placement
    Local area
    Flexible hours

    GEICO

    Bethesda, MD
    1 day ago
  • $195k - $257.5k

     ...Data Platform Engineering Team Circle is committed to visibility and stability in everything we do...  ...You'll bring to Circle: Senior Software Engineer (III): ~4+ years of software...  ...databases such as Bigtable, Cassandra Staff Software Engineer (IV): Includes... 
    Suggested
    Contract work
    Remote work
    Flexible hours

    Circle

    Washington DC
    22 days ago
  • $253.9k - $298.7k

     ...products, but a world-class data foundation beneath them. The Data Platform team is the engine that makes Coinbase's data reliable...  ...visionary, hands-on Senior Staff Software Engineer to help define and...  ...that matters at the infrastructure level of one of the most important... 
    Suggested
    Local area

    Coinbase

    Washington DC
    1 day ago
  • $220k - $292k

     ...operating system that turns thousands of data streams into a realtime, 3D...  ...as the backbone of Anduril's engineering ecosystem, building critical infrastructure that enables teams to deliver mission...  .../CD workflows powering Anduril's Software Factories across the US,... 
    Suggested
    Full time
    Work experience placement
    Immediate start

    Anduril Industries

    Washington DC
    1 day ago
  • $197.4k - $232k

     ...Remote Department Engineering Compensation: $197.4K -...  ...better tech. We're rewriting how data moves and what the world can...  ...About the Role: As a Software Engineer on the Compute Platform...  ...for our global compute infrastructure What You Will Bring: ~8... 
    Full time
    Remote work

    Confluent

    Washington DC
    4 days ago
  • $218.03k - $256.5k

     ...and fully supported. We're hiring a Staff Software Engineer to lead the Identity Accounts team —...  ...-teams: Foundations (authorization infrastructure), Users Platformization (decomposing...  ...tutorial can be found here). Global Data Privacy Notice for Job Candidates and... 
    Local area

    Coinbase

    Washington DC
    2 days ago
  • $200k - $250k

     ...Staff Software Engineer, AI Platform Flex is a growth-stage, NYC headquartered FinTech company that is creating the best rent payment...  ...integrating them into team workflows. ~ Experience with agent infrastructure and code-execution sandboxes (Modal, E2B, Cloudflare... 
    Full time
    Local area
    Relocation package
    Flexible hours
    2 days per week
    3 days per week

    FLEX Inc

    Washington DC
    4 days ago
  • $120k - $260k

     ...GEICO is seeking an experienced Senior Staff Software Engineer with a passion for building high...  ..., Pulumi, Terraform) for streamlined infrastructure provisioning. Professional experience...  ...for secure configurations and data protection. Proven in optimizing CI... 
    Hourly pay
    Work experience placement
    Local area
    Flexible hours

    GEICO

    Bethesda, MD
    3 days ago
  • $110k - $230k

     ...Lead Backend Software Engineer At GEICO, we offer a rewarding career where your ambitions are met with endless possibilities. Every...  ...The Billing Platform team at GEICO oversees the tools, infrastructure, data, reporting, analytics, and services essential for delivering... 
    Hourly pay
    Work experience placement
    Local area
    Flexible hours

    GEICO

    Chevy Chase, MD
    2 days ago
  • $218.03k - $256.5k

     ...fully supported. We are looking for a Staff Software Engineer to join the Payment Rails team within...  ...building payment systems, financial infrastructure, or high-volume transactional systems...  ...can be found here). Global Data Privacy Notice for Job Candidates and... 
    Local area

    Coinbase

    Washington DC
    14 hours ago
  • $218.03k - $256.5k

     ...designed property of the infrastructure, not a coordination...  ...problem between teams. At staff-level, you’ll define...  ..., real-time detection engine, and the APIs and...  ...requirements) : ~8+ years of software engineering experience...  ...scale. Streaming data infrastructure (Kafka,... 
    Local area

    Coinbase

    Washington DC
    4 days ago
  • $218.03k - $256.5k

     ...these fund movements. Our tooling serves Engineering, Customer Experience, Risk, and...  ...operates faster and more safely. As a Staff Software Engineer, you will own the technical strategy...  ...tutorial can be found here). Global Data Privacy Notice for Job Candidates and... 
    Local area

    Coinbase

    Washington DC
    4 days ago
  • $148k - $160k

    Great Minds is seeking a Staff Engineer to lead and mentor a team while contributing to software design and delivery. This remote role requires 5 years of engineering experience with strong cloud-native application design skills. Candidates should be proficient in JavaScript... 
    Remote job

    Great Minds

    Washington DC
    4 days ago
  • $140k - $210k

     ...(*Comscore, Total Visits, March 2025) Day to Day As a Software Engineer IV (ML) on the Machine Learning Model Platform team at Indeed...  ...and scalability. You will engage in close collaboration with Data Scientists to ascertain their requirements, spearhead technical... 
    Temporary work
    Work experience placement
    Local area

    Indeed Inc.

    Washington DC
    10 days ago
  •  ...Description Our group seeks a full-time Staff Software Engineer to help build an advanced modeling & simulation capability. The position supports a prototype that will be delivered as part of an interagency team to the U.S. Government. You will be working with others... 
    Full time
    Contract work
    Work experience placement
    Live in

    Applied Research Associates

    Arlington, VA
    4 days ago
  • $100k - $260k

     ...experienced full-stack engineer with a deep technical...  .... As a Senior Staff Engineer, you're not just...  ...detection authoring, security data pipeline, reporting,...  ...works closely with infrastructure, development, product,...  ...program strategy, software development, integration... 
    Hourly pay
    Work experience placement
    Internship
    Local area
    Flexible hours

    GEICO

    Bethesda, MD
    3 days ago
  • $220k - $275k

     ...Datavant is the data collaboration platform trusted for healthcare. Guided by...  ...transformative change in healthcare. Staff Software Engineer The Role As a Staff Software...  ...for full-stack or cross-domain work) Infrastructure & Cloud: AWS, multi-cloud architectures... 

    Datavant

    Washington DC
    3 days ago
  • $235.7k - $277k

     ...Remote Department Engineering Compensation: $235.7K -...  ...better tech. We're rewriting how data moves and what the world can...  ...: ~10+ years of relevant software development experience. ~...  ...API servers, or cloud-native infrastructure. Knowledge of containerization... 
    Full time
    Remote work

    Confluent

    Washington DC
    14 hours ago
  • $160.2k - $290.7k

     ...develops the first layers of software on the GM Autonomous...  ...to moving large amounts of data up the software stack. Within...  ...platforms. Role As a Staff Software Engineers, you are the expert professionals...  ...and implement shared infrastructure and tooling among theAV Platform... 
    Work experience placement
    Local area
    Remote work
    Work from home
    Relocation package
    Flexible hours

    General Motors

    Washington DC
    14 hours ago
  •  ...the Team Join the engineering teams that bring...  ...Role We're seeking Software Engineers who can solve...  ...new environments and infrastructure that power critical missions...  ...at both the model & data layers. Collaborate...  ...Member of Technical Staff . We use Senior Staff... 

    OpenAI

    Washington DC
    3 days ago
  • $100k - $230k

     ...Rewards and Great Careers. GEICO is seeking an experienced Staff Software Engineer to join our Knowledge Graph and Content Generation...  ...graph systems, automated content generation workflows, semantic data platforms, and intelligent content delivery solutions that empower... 
    Hourly pay
    Work experience placement
    Local area
    Flexible hours

    GEICO

    Bethesda, MD
    3 days ago
  • $187.53k - $281.3k

     ...assembled a diverse team of experts in software, robotics, control systems, optimization, and data analysis to create software...  ...integration, hardware, and test engineering to solve some of the hardest...  ...customers. About the Job: Staff Software Engineers on the Autonomy... 
    Full time
    Temporary work
    Part time
    Worldwide

    Shield AI

    Washington DC
    1 day ago
  • $172.8k - $251.65k

     ...workflows, and analysis approaches that enable data-driven decisions across AV development...  ...analyses to evaluate autonomous driving software performance across the autonomy stack....  ...efforts with autonomy, systems engineering, simulation, and data teams to embed evaluation... 
    Local area
    Remote work
    Work from home
    Relocation
    Relocation package
    Flexible hours

    General Motors

    Washington DC
    4 days ago
  • $60 per hour

    An AI development company is seeking programmers to join their team and work on state-of-the-art AI systems. This fully remote position allows you to choose projects that suit your schedule, with pay up to $60 USD/hour depending on performance. Responsibilities include ...
    Remote work

    DataAnnotation

    Washington DC
    11 days ago
  • $134k - $235.9k

     ...partners Behaviors, Perception, and Safety Engineers. The specific duties may include...  ..., integration, creating ML infrastructure, metrics, and data pipelines for production model deployment...  ...of an ML team and contribute strong software engineering (SWE) expertise.... 
    Local area
    Remote work
    Work from home
    Relocation
    Relocation package
    Flexible hours
    Shift work

    General Motors

    Washington DC
    3 days ago
  • $220k - $330k

     ...Staff Software Engineer Anduril Industries is a defense technology company with a mission to transform...  ...system that turns thousands of data streams into a realtime, 3D command...  ...organization, ensuring we build on solid infrastructure while influencing platform... 
    Full time
    Temporary work
    Work experience placement
    Immediate start

    anduril

    Washington DC
    9 hours ago
  • $140k - $200k

     ...Staff Software Engineer - Ad Serving As a Staff Software Engineer on our Runtime team, you will work directly with Viant's ad server, managing a high-volume, low-latency application that processes billions of unique requests a day. This role offers a great opportunity... 
    Temporary work
    Work experience placement

    Viant

    Washington DC
    3 days ago
  • $230.8k - $271.2k

     ...: Remote Department Engineering Compensation: $230.8K -...  ...better tech. We're rewriting how data moves and what the world can...  ...an innovative and executing Staff Engineer to help make stream...  ...Bring: ~10+ years of relevant software development experience. ~... 
    Full time
    Remote work

    Confluent

    Washington DC
    8 days ago
  •  ...Staff Software Engineer - Log Management United States About Us Radiant Security is building...  ...— from ingestion to storage in our data lake. When customers face active...  ...scalability and reliability of our ingestion infrastructure, define the architecture of our data... 

    Radiant Security

    Washington DC
    3 days ago

Do you want to receive more vacancies?

Subscribe and receive similar vacancies to Staff Software Engineer, Data Infrastructure. Be the first to apply!